Florida is the nation’s 4th most
populous state, Florida experienced
a rate of growth of 1.3%
between July '05  & '06.
Professional & business services
continued to lead the super sectors
in employment growth over the year,
adding 35,400 jobs.
Education & health services
 jobs up 2.7%, & trade,
transportation & utilities
jobs,  posted the next
greatest job gains.

Employment Statistics - Pinellas County

November 2007*

2,692 Initial Unemployment

Compensation Claims

⇓ Down 16% October 2007

⇑ Up 32% November 2006

Unemployment Rate

• 4.2% Pinellas County, Nov. ‘07

• 4.4% Tampa Bay MSA, Nov. ‘07

• 4.2% Florida, Nov. ‘07

• 4.5% U.S., Nov. ‘07

* Source: Agency for Workforce Innovation;

Numbers Not Seasonally Adjusted

Based on the latest nationwide data, Florida ranked third in job growth

rate among the ten most populous states, behind Texas and Georgia.

Job growth was faster in the Tampa Bay MSA than the state in:

professional and business services (+2.8%); natural resources, mining, and construction (+1.1%); and information (+0.9%).

Pinellas Civilian Labor Force 489,207

Unemployed Pinellas Citizens  20,315

Over-the-Year Job Growth Tampa-St. Pete-Clearwater MSA +12,400 new jobs in 2007

Annual Wage (Pinellas County ‘06) $36,981

Cost of Living in Pinellas County is 99.2 % of the national average. The State of Florida is 100.4%
